Space Protection Programs is seeking a dynamic Software Engineering Project Manager who will serve as Deputy Lead for an Integrated Product Team (IPT). The ideal candidate will combine strong project‑management expertise with deep engineering know‑how to drive complex, multi‑disciplinary programs from concept through production. This role will support the IPT Lead in steering technical direction, managing schedules, risks, and resources, and ensuring compliance with customer and regulatory requirements. In this role you will: - Drive software development & integration – Oversee flight software development, integration, and verification activities, ensuring deliverables meet technical, schedule, and quality objectives. - Own the integrated software program plan – Develop, maintain, and regularly baseline the IPT‑wide schedule, cost baseline, and performance target documents; track earned‑value, forecast variances, and drive corrective actions to keep the program on‑track. - Collaborate with other Program IPTs – Act as the primary liaison between the Software IPT and Systems, Test, Hardware, and Mission‑Level IPTs; align milestone dates, data‑exchange interfaces, and resource commitments across the full program architecture. - Work with software functional leadership to establish demand for program efforts and assist in staffing planning activities - Conduct trade studies, risk analyses, and mitigation planning to protect schedule and budget health. Basic Qualifications 
 • Previous experience in Flight Software or embedded software for satellite, or product development programs. • Previous experience as a Product Owner and/or software lead •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ering or a related discipline • Previous experience in an Agile software program with Program Increment Planning, Scrum, and Sprint Planning across multiple software components/teams Desired Skills
